Distilled water is used in pollen germination experiments because it is free from impurities and contaminants that could potentially affect the results of the experiment. By using distilled water, researchers can ensure that any growth or changes observed in the pollen are solely due to the experimental conditions being studied.

The purpose of using multiple control groups in an experiment is to enhance the validity and reliability of the results by isolating the effects of the independent variable. Different control groups can account for various factors that might influence the outcome, allowing researchers to identify specific effects more accurately. By comparing results across these groups, researchers can better understand the influence of confounding variables and ensure that the observed effects are due to the treatment being tested. This approach ultimately strengthens the overall conclusions drawn from the experiment.

Increasing the sample size, replicating the experiment multiple times, and ensuring control over variables would have made the experiment more reliable. Additionally, using random assignment and blinding techniques could have also increased reliability.
To ensure an experiment is valid, start by clearly defining your hypothesis and the variables involved. Control for extraneous variables by keeping conditions consistent and using a suitable sample size. Implement appropriate controls, such as a control group, to compare results. Finally, repeat the experiment multiple times to confirm findings and reduce the likelihood of anomalies.

The purpose of using a wash buffer in a western blot experiment is to remove any unbound or nonspecifically bound antibodies or proteins from the membrane, helping to increase the specificity and accuracy of the results.
